Honda Jazz is clearly cheaper – starting at 22,200 £ , while the KGM Actyon costs 30,700 £ . That’s a price difference of around 8,477 £.
Fuel consumption also shows a difference: the Honda Jazz uses 4.5 L/100km and is clearly more efficient than the KGM Actyon with 6.1 L/100km. The difference is about 1.6 L/100km.
Under the bonnet, it becomes clear which model is tuned for sportiness and which one takes the lead when you hit the accelerator.
When it comes to engine power, the KGM Actyon offers significantly more power – delivering 204 HP compared to 122 HP. That’s roughly 82 HP more horsepower.
There’s also a difference in torque: the KGM Actyon delivers only slightly more torque with 280 Nm compared to 253 Nm. That’s about 27 Nm more.
Whether family car or daily driver – which one offers more room, flexibility and comfort?
Both vehicles offer seating for 5 people.
In terms of curb weight, Honda Jazz is moderately lighter – 1,302 kg compared to 1,550 kg. The difference is around 248 kg.
Looking at boot space, the KGM Actyon offers clearly more boot space – 668 L compared to 304 L. That’s a difference of about 364 L.
When it comes to payload, the KGM Actyon carries visibly more – 565 kg compared to 388 kg. That’s a difference of about 177 kg.

The SsangYong Actyon is a compact crossover with distinctive, angular styling and a practical, versatile interior that feels purposeful rather than flashy. It suits buyers who want a budget-minded, no-nonsense vehicle offering everyday comfort and straightforward, reliable engineering.

The Honda Jazz is a supremely practical small hatch that hides clever packaging and more usable space than it lets on, with friendly styling and an unfussy charm. It’s economical to run, easy to park and perfect for buyers who want reliable, versatile daily motoring without the hassle.
